## Larkspur environments

Quick note for review: we enable per-message deflate only in prod, since the CPU cost on the edge boxes is real and compression of attacker-influenced frames is the usual worry. Staging runs uncompressed so we can diff traffic easily. The current per-environment settings are listed below.

settings of kagag-kagef:
[kelath]
port = 9300
region = west-4
host = kelath.olvarqworks.example
team = sorion
timeout_ms = 1000
retries = 8

Handover: bulk edits in the Ledgerview admin table

Marek — I merged the batch-update endpoint but the row-selection UI still allows edits across filtered-out pages, which caused the Quillon tenant incident. The fix branch guards selection by visible rows only; please review the transaction boundaries closely. Known edge cases and test notes are documented on the internal page below.

dashboard of bafof-hafog = https://confluence.lumiclabs.internal/display/browse/display/6a09a20a

## Sensor drift: what to do at 3am

If the GrowLoop controller starts reporting humidity swings that don't match the backup probes in the Fernwick greenhouse, it's almost always sensor drift, not an actual climate event. Don't panic and don't touch the vents manually. First, restart the calibration daemon and give it ten minutes to re-baseline. If readings still disagree by more than 5%, flip the controller into safe mode. The safe-mode thresholds it will use are these.

config for yahap-bajof:
[istix]
host = istix.qorvelsys.internal
user = istix_svc
database = istix_prod

Runbook fragment 4.2 — Trophy engraving, Silverline Awards Night

Collect the twelve blank trophies from the Marwick Hall store room no later than three working days before the event. Deliver them to Oakhurst Engravers with the approved name list, checked twice against the nominations register. Allow forty-eight hours for engraving and one full day for inspection on return. For the return leg, the courier hand-over must follow the confidential instruction set out below.

dispatch memo: the lamwyn fenwyn courier leaves the wenir ledger at gate 7175 under passcode 822969